Indian equity indices were upbeat in the afternoon session, owing to widespread purchasing in blue chip stocks. Traders were encouraged as foreign investors turned net purchasers after eight days of being net sellers. According to National Stock Exchange statistics, international portfolio investors purchased securities worth Rs 590.58 on Monday.

Asian markets were trading higher with Taiwan Weighted gaining 276.04 points or 2.08% to 13,576.52, KOSPI climbed 53.89 points or 2.5% to 2,209.38, Straits Times increased 24.82 points or 0.8% to 3,131.91, Jakarta Composite rose 55.90 points or 0.8% to 7,065.62 and Nikkei 225 was up by 776.42 points or 2.96% to 26,992.21.

The Sensex is presently trading at 57,934.71, up 1145.90 points or 2.02% from a low of 57,506.65 and a high of 58,035.69. On the index, 28 equities advanced while only two declined.

The broader indices were trading in green with the BSE Midcap index rising 1.99%, while the Small cap index was up by 1.42%. The top gaining sectoral indices on the BSE were Bankex up by 2.50%, Metal up by 2.39%, IT up by 2.38%, Power up by 2.28% and Utilities was up by 2.26%, while there were no losing sectoral indices on the BSE.

The biggest gainers on the Sensex were IndusInd Bank (+4.84%), Bajaj Finance (+3.64%), TCS (+2.95%), HDFC (+2.85%), and Bajaj Finserv (+2.69%). The only losers were Power Grid, which fell by 0.93%, and Dr Reddy’s Lab, which fell by 0.22%.

The Nifty is presently trading at 17,237.15, up 349.80 points or 2.07% after fluctuating in a range of 17,117.30 and 17,257.55. On the index, 48 equities advanced while only two declined.

The biggest gainers on the Nifty were IndusInd Bank (+4.86%), Adani Ports (+4.47%), Hero MotoCorp (+3.60%), Bajaj Finance (+3.57%), and Adani Enterprises (+3.28%). The few losers were Power Grid, which fell by 1.00%, and Dr Reddy’s Lab, which fell by 0.19%.
